RapidFax is a very cheap email to fax - fax to email service for small businesses and home offices. For only $9.95 per month, you receive 300 free inbound or outbound fax pages. Extra pages are only $0.08 per page. Setup is fast and free. ...

We are a company who is hitting their busy time of the year and therefore we need more extensions to be active. I called on a Monday morning to have 2 extensions activated so our customers could call and we could make sales. I was told to email support and I was assured it would be taken care of that day. Well Monday passed, Tuesday passed and still nothing. Despite my follow up email on Tuesday. Into Wednesday, I called and explained it is very important we get these extensions active and could they just put me on hold and do it. They claimed they didn't get ANY of my emails. Keep in mind I emailed them from multiple accounts and from THEIR contact forms. I emailed AGAIN from the same accounts and on SUPPORT forms on their website. And surprise surprise it's the end of the day on Wednesday and nothing. Customer service is a joke. They do not care and now my company has gone almost the whole week without extensions we need.

DO NOT SIGN UP for this service!! After the 30 day trial, they start charging and it is IMPOSSIBLE to cancel. You cannot cancel online or any other way. I talked to people and I chatted online but it was impossible. I cancelled my credit card and still it was charged to my new card. (My credit card company said that if they have the 3 digit code on the back, they can push it through.) Now I've filed a dispute with my credit card company and I hope that will work.
At $9.95 per month, I feel that RapidFax's individual and small business plan is a competitively priced internet fax service option. They offer a thirty day trial period which includes 300 total pages. Unlike other internet fax services that set an allotted number for incoming and outgoing pages, RapidFax combines the two to give their users more flexibility in how they spend their minutes. They also DO NOT charge a setup fee for their service. Faxes can only be sent to two email addresses which has not been a problem for me.
